ZIP Code Tabulation Areas (ZCTAs) are Census approximations of USPS ZIP codes. Boundaries may differ slightly from postal delivery areas, and estimates for less-populated ZCTAs carry higher margins of error.

Data: U.S. Census Bureau, 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023 (released December 2024).

Quick Facts — 12108

What is the median household income in 12108?
The median household income in 12108 is $76,786 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023).
What is the poverty rate in 12108?
The poverty rate in 12108 is 0.0% (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the median home value in 12108?
$275,000 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the average rent in 12108?
The median gross rent in 12108 is $956 per month (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What percentage of 12108 residents have a college degree?
28.1% of adults in 12108 hold a bachelor's degree or higher (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
